Leaking Basement Repair in Greenville, SC
Leaking basement repair services address issues related to water intrusion that can compromise the integrity and safety of a property. These projects typically involve identifying sources of leaks, such as cracks in foundation walls, faulty drainage systems, or plumbing failures, and implementing solutions to stop water from entering the basement. Property owners often seek this service to prevent water damage, mold growth, and structural deterioration, ensuring a dry and healthy living or working environment.
Before requesting leaking basement repair, homeowners usually want to understand the extent of the water intrusion, potential causes, and the best methods for remediation. It is helpful to know if there are visible signs of leaks, such as damp walls, musty odors, or water stains, as well as any history of flooding or drainage issues. Clarifying these details can assist in selecting appropriate repair options and avoiding future problems related to basement moisture or flooding.

Common Leaking Basement Repair Jobs
Basement wall sealing - prevents water from seeping through foundation walls.
Leak detection - identifies the source of water intrusion in the basement.
Drainage system installation - directs water away from the foundation to reduce basement flooding.
Crack repair - seals foundation cracks that can allow water entry.
Waterproofing solutions - create a moisture barrier to protect basement interiors.
Sump pump installation - removes accumulated water to prevent basement flooding.
Leaking Basement Repair Questions
What causes basement leaks? Basement leaks often result from poor drainage, foundation cracks, or hydrostatic pressure from groundwater buildup.
How can I tell if my basement is leaking? Signs include damp walls, water stains, mold growth, or a musty odor in the basement area.
Are there common areas where leaks occur? Leaks frequently happen around basement windows, floor joints, or where the foundation has cracks or gaps.
What are typical repair options for a leaking basement? Repairs may involve sealing cracks, installing drainage systems, or applying waterproof coatings to prevent moisture intrusion.
